Not for human or veterinary use.<\/strong><\/p>\n<h2>What Is Rifampicin, 450 mg?<\/h2>\n<p>Rifampicin, 450 mg, is a semi-synthetic antibiotic derived from <i>Amycolatopsis rifamycinica<\/i>. It belongs to the rifamycin class of antibiotics and inhibits bacterial DNA-dependent RNA polymerase. Rifampicin finds applications in pharmaceutical research, particularly in studies related to antibiotic development, drug resistance mechanisms, and mycobacterial infections.
